G09G5/24

FONT CREATION APPARATUS, FONT CREATION METHOD, AND FONT CREATION PROGRAM

There are provided a font creation apparatus, a font creation method, and a font creation program capable of generating, from small-number character images having a desired-to-be-imitated style, a complete font set for any language having the same style as the character images. A feature amount extraction unit (40) receives a character image (32) of a first font having a desired-to-be-imitated style and extracts a first feature amount of the first font of the character image (32). An estimation unit (42) estimates a transformation parameter between the extracted first feature amount and a second feature amount of a reference second font (34). A feature amount generation unit (44) generates a fourth feature amount of a second font set to be created by transforming a third feature amount of a complete reference font set (36) based on the estimated transformation parameter. A font generation unit (46) generates a complete second font set by converting the generated fourth feature amount of the second font set into an image.

CHARACTER STRING DISPLAY DEVICE AND CHARACTER STRING DISPLAY METHOD
20210193080 · 2021-06-24 · ·

There is provided a character string display device including a character string display unit (10) including a plurality of display elements (110) arrayed two-dimensionally, and a display controller (20) configured to cause the character string display unit (10) to display a predetermined character string pattern by controlling display states of the plurality of display elements (110). In the character string display device, the display controller (20) is configured to cause the character string display unit (10) to display the character string pattern such that there is no blank line between consecutive character patterns of the character string pattern and that, when two display elements corresponding to the respective consecutive character patterns are adjacent to each other, a character pattern part corresponding to one of the adjacent display elements (110) is not displayed. The character string display device and a character string display method are simple and low cost, allow effective use of display space, and achieve higher legibility of a character string.

CHARACTER STRING DISPLAY DEVICE AND CHARACTER STRING DISPLAY METHOD
20210193080 · 2021-06-24 · ·

There is provided a character string display device including a character string display unit (10) including a plurality of display elements (110) arrayed two-dimensionally, and a display controller (20) configured to cause the character string display unit (10) to display a predetermined character string pattern by controlling display states of the plurality of display elements (110). In the character string display device, the display controller (20) is configured to cause the character string display unit (10) to display the character string pattern such that there is no blank line between consecutive character patterns of the character string pattern and that, when two display elements corresponding to the respective consecutive character patterns are adjacent to each other, a character pattern part corresponding to one of the adjacent display elements (110) is not displayed. The character string display device and a character string display method are simple and low cost, allow effective use of display space, and achieve higher legibility of a character string.

Hardware-based graphics interface for medical device sensors and controllers

A completely hardware-based graphics interface controller for reading values from sensors or outputting voltages, currents, or other electrical parameters to medical devices is proposed. The graphics interface controller accepts analog or digital input into a programmable logic device (PLD), whose logic gates convert the input value to memory addresses of bitmaps that represent digits or other characters. The bitmaps are copied to respective x, y coordinates in a frame buffer, which are then displayed on a matrix liquid crystal display (LCD) panel. The bitmaps can be simple or elaborate, mimicking the rich look and feel of general purpose computer fonts so that the display output is compelling and modern-looking despite being entirely hardware based. A ventilator or other medical device can be instrumented with one or more sensors whose outputs are to the graphics interface, and an alarm can be triggered for off-nominal conditions.

Acquisition of a font portion using a compression mechanism
11030389 · 2021-06-08 · ·

Acquisition of a font portion using a compression mechanism is described. In certain embodiments, an end-user device determines multiple characters to be displayed but are missing from a local font. The end-user device computes a compressed representation of the multiple characters based on multiple code points corresponding to the multiple characters. The end-user device transmits a font request including the compressed representation to a font repository. The font request may be implemented as a uniform resource locator (URL). The font repository, such as a server, decodes the compressed representation to identify at least the multiple code points encoded by the end-user device. The font repository prepares a font description including glyph data corresponding to the multiple code points and returns the font description. The end-user device produces a local font that includes at least multiple glyphs corresponding to the multiple requested characters. The local font production may include font augmentation.

Acquisition of a font portion using a compression mechanism
11030389 · 2021-06-08 · ·

Acquisition of a font portion using a compression mechanism is described. In certain embodiments, an end-user device determines multiple characters to be displayed but are missing from a local font. The end-user device computes a compressed representation of the multiple characters based on multiple code points corresponding to the multiple characters. The end-user device transmits a font request including the compressed representation to a font repository. The font request may be implemented as a uniform resource locator (URL). The font repository, such as a server, decodes the compressed representation to identify at least the multiple code points encoded by the end-user device. The font repository prepares a font description including glyph data corresponding to the multiple code points and returns the font description. The end-user device produces a local font that includes at least multiple glyphs corresponding to the multiple requested characters. The local font production may include font augmentation.

Device and method for driving a display panel

A processing system comprises a first IC chip and a second IC chip. The first IC chip comprises first image processing circuitry, first display panel driver circuitry, and first communication circuitry. The first image processing circuitry is configured to generate a first overlay image by overlaying a first partial input image with a first image element based on first partial input image data representing the first partial input image and first image element data representing the first image element. The first display panel driver circuitry is configured to drive a display panel based on the first overlay image. The first communication circuitry is configured to output second image element data representing a second image element to the second IC chip.

Selectively enabling trackpad functionality in graphical interfaces
10983679 · 2021-04-20 · ·

A content manipulation application provides a graphical interface for editing graphical content. The graphical interface includes first and second control elements for performing first and second manipulations of the graphical content. If the first control element is selected, the content management application switches the graphical interface to a trackpad mode. The trackpad mode disables the second control element and thereby prevents the second control element from performing the second manipulation. While the graphical interface is in the trackpad mode, the content management application receives an input in an input area that lacks the first control element and performs the first manipulation of the graphical content responsive to receiving the input. Subsequent to the first manipulation being performed, the graphical interface is switched out of the trackpad mode, thereby enabling the second control element to perform the second manipulation.

Selectively enabling trackpad functionality in graphical interfaces
10983679 · 2021-04-20 · ·

A content manipulation application provides a graphical interface for editing graphical content. The graphical interface includes first and second control elements for performing first and second manipulations of the graphical content. If the first control element is selected, the content management application switches the graphical interface to a trackpad mode. The trackpad mode disables the second control element and thereby prevents the second control element from performing the second manipulation. While the graphical interface is in the trackpad mode, the content management application receives an input in an input area that lacks the first control element and performs the first manipulation of the graphical content responsive to receiving the input. Subsequent to the first manipulation being performed, the graphical interface is switched out of the trackpad mode, thereby enabling the second control element to perform the second manipulation.

DEVICE AND METHOD FOR DRIVING A DISPLAY PANEL
20210110793 · 2021-04-15 ·

A processing system comprises a first IC chip and a second IC chip. The first IC chip comprises first image processing circuitry, first display panel driver circuitry, and first communication circuitry. The first image processing circuitry is configured to generate a first overlay image by overlaying a first partial input image with a first image element based on first partial input image data representing the first partial input image and first image element data representing the first image element. The first display panel driver circuitry is configured to drive a display panel based on the first overlay image. The first communication circuitry is configured to output second image element data representing a second image element to the second IC chip.